Handover — Billsworth worker deploys

Welcome aboard. The billing worker ships via blue-green: green takes traffic, blue stays warm for rollback. Cut over only after the invoice backlog drains below 100. Rollback is one command in the deploy console; never edit the worker in place. Console access requires unsealing the ops vault first, which you do with the passphrase below.

vault phrase of bagaf-kajeg = jorath-feniel-briir-siliel-ralix

Subject: Transition to Annual Billing — Guidance for Sales Leads

Team,

Beginning next quarter, Orvane Systems will move all new Clearpath contracts to annual billing. Please brief your sales leads carefully: existing monthly accounts are unaffected until renewal, and discount authority remains unchanged. Messaging materials arrive Friday. This shift directly supports the strategic direction summarized in the note below.

— Mirela

internal memo for hahif-hahaf: Headcount on the Zorwyn team goes from 9 to 100 by the end of October. Gross margin on Zorwyn came in at 5 percent against a plan of 10 percent.

# Env file — Cartwheel dispatch, driver-assignment heuristic
# Scope: staging only. Do not promote to prod.
# The heuristic weights (proximity, shift balance, refusal rate) are tuned
# for the Velmont pilot region and will misbehave elsewhere.
# Review notes: heuristic service runs unprivileged; it reads weights
# read-only from the tuning store and writes nothing back.
# Only one sensitive value exists in this file: the tuning-store access
# credential, consumed at boot and never logged.
# That credential is set on the following line.

secret setting of faduf-bahop: LEDGER_TOKEN8=c3b363be